Despite the ongoing adjustments in the tech market, substantial capital continues to flow into promising startups, particularly those leveraging artificial intelligence or addressing critical sectors like healthcare. OpenAI is reportedly in talks for another significant private funding round at a $1.2 trillion valuation, signaling sustained investor confidence in its AI leadership. Similarly, AI-focused companies like Profound and CADDi have recently achieved unicorn status with large funding rounds, indicating a strong demand for AI solutions across various industries, from marketing to manufacturing.

The healthcare sector is also seeing significant startup activity, driven by rising costs and evolving employee demands. Health benefits platform Thatch has reached a $1 billion valuation, highlighting its success in offering flexible healthcare solutions to employers and employees. Other health-tech ventures, such as Evvy focusing on women's health research, are also attracting substantial investment, pointing to a broader trend of innovation aimed at modernizing healthcare delivery and data utilization.

While many startups are thriving, the AI sector also presents a cautionary tale, with a notable list of projects and companies failing to gain traction. This dynamic underscores the competitive nature of the startup ecosystem, where rapid innovation and market fit are crucial for survival and success. Acquisitions, such as DoorDash's move to acquire a dining business, also reflect ongoing consolidation and strategic shifts within the industry.
